Shell CEO hesitant to invest equity in US LNG infrastructure

Thursday, 12 February 2026

Shell CEO Wael Sawan has expressed reluctance to spend the company’s own equity on US LNG projects, citing the availability of low-cost infrastructure funding. His remark signals a shift towards prioritising shareholder returns over equity commitment in an increasingly oversupplied global LNG market.
